Stainless Steel

Stainless steel is one of the most popular materials used in cooking ware. It is durable, scratch-resistant, and non-reactive, making it a great choice for cooking a wide variety of foods. Stainless steel cookware is easy to clean and maintain, making it ideal for everyday use.

When cooking with stainless steel, it is important to preheat the pan before adding ingredients to ensure even cooking. Stainless steel cookware may not be the best option for tasks that require high heat, such as searing meat, as it does not conduct heat as well as other materials.

Cast Iron

Cast iron cookware has been used for centuries and is known for its excellent heat retention and distribution. Cast iron skillets and Dutch ovens are perfect for searing meat, frying, and baking. They are also ideal for slow cooking and simmering dishes.

To maintain cast iron cookware, it is important to season it regularly with oil to create a non-stick surface. Cast iron cookware can be heavy and requires special care, but with proper maintenance, it can last a lifetime.

Non-Stick

Non-stick cookware is coated with a layer of polytetrafluoroethylene (PTFE) or ceramic to prevent food from sticking to the surface. Non-stick cookware is easy to clean and requires little to no oil for cooking, making it a great choice for those looking to reduce their fat intake.

However, non-stick cookware should not be used at high temperatures, as it can release toxic fumes when overheated. It is also not recommended for use with metal utensils, as they can scratch the non-stick coating.

Copper

Copper cookware is prized by chefs for its excellent heat conductivity and responsiveness. Copper pans heat up quickly and distribute heat evenly, making them perfect for tasks that require precise temperature control, such as making sauces and caramel.

Copper cookware requires regular polishing to maintain its shine and prevent tarnishing. It is also on the expensive side and may react with acidic foods if not lined with another material, such as stainless steel or tin.

Aluminum

Aluminum is a lightweight and affordable material used in cooking ware. It heats up quickly and evenly, making it a popular choice for sautéing and frying. However, aluminum is reactive and can impart a metallic taste to acidic foods. To prevent this, aluminum cookware is often coated with a non-reactive material, such as stainless steel or anodized aluminum.

Anodized aluminum cookware is treated with a special process that makes it non-reactive and scratch-resistant. It is also more durable than traditional aluminum cookware and is a great option for everyday cooking.

Ceramic

Ceramic cookware is made from clay that is kiln-fired to create a non-stick surface. Ceramic cookware is free of PTFE and PFOA, making it a safe and eco-friendly option. It is also scratch-resistant and can withstand high temperatures, making it ideal for baking and roasting.

Ceramic cookware should be handled with care to prevent chipping or cracking. It is also important to avoid sudden changes in temperature, as ceramic cookware may crack when exposed to extreme heat or cold.
